    SMB Slow Speeds

    I dont know how you guys get good SMB copy speeds over the network i have the issue with my HP gen 8 xeon on esxi 6.5 SATA setup (no scsi raid), with synology 5.2 , 6.1 1.02 , 6.1 1.02a so all versions in fact what happens, i do a clean install, just setup 1 shared folder so i start copying from my laptop over 1 gb network to synology, transfer speeds are looking verry good, arround 110 MB/sec , then after a miniute or something, the speed drops to like 8-9 MB and is verry slow and constant drops (tested with a file of 5-10 GB) PS: dont have issues when running in bare metal here below some screens of my setup doesnt mather if i add more/less processors/memory, also tried SATA controller/SCSI controller what am i missing to get good SMB speeds? thnx screens see attached
